1. Mayo Clinic — United States
is one of the most recognised names in global healthcare. Its main campus is in Rochester, Minnesota, while it also operates major campuses in Arizona and Florida.
Mayo Clinic is known for bringing different specialists together to solve complicated medical problems. A patient may have several health issues at the same time. Instead of visiting different places again and again, specialists can collaborate on the case.
The hospital is especially strong in areas such as cardiology, oncology, neurology, gastroenterology and transplantation.
Research is another major strength. Mayo Clinic is not just treating patients. It is also working on new ways to diagnose and treat diseases.
2. Cleveland Clinic — United States
has earned a global reputation, particularly for heart and cardiovascular care.
Located in Cleveland, Ohio, the organisation combines clinical care with medical research and education. Its heart program is one of its most famous areas, attracting patients from different countries.
But cardiology is not the only speciality. Cleveland Clinic also provides advanced treatment in neurology, cancer care, digestive diseases, orthopaedics and many other fields.
The hospital’s approach is highly team-based. Doctors from different specialties work together. This can be especially useful for complex cases.

4. Massachusetts General Hospital — United States
, often called Mass General, is one of the major teaching hospitals in the United States.
Based in Boston, Massachusetts, the hospital provides advanced care across numerous specialties. It is particularly respected for cancer treatment, cardiology, neurology, orthopaedics and emergency medicine.
Mass General is also a major research centre. Scientists and doctors work on new treatments, medical technologies and better ways to understand diseases.
For patients with complicated conditions, access to multiple specialists can be a major advantage. Everything feels connected.

Final Thoughts
The world’s top hospitals are not necessarily the same for every patient. A hospital that is excellent for heart surgery may not be the best choice for cancer treatment. Another may be stronger in neurology or transplantation.
That is why patients should look beyond rankings. Check the specialist. Look at treatment options. Consider experience with the specific condition. Cost and location matter too.
Mayo Clinic, Cleveland Clinic, Johns Hopkins Hospital, Massachusetts General Hospital and Charité are all leading names in global healthcare.
But the “best” hospital is often the one with the right doctor, right treatment and right support for a particular patient. Sometimes, that is what matters most.
